Ground Clearing in Houston, TX
Ground clearing services involve removing trees, shrubs, brush, and other obstructions to prepare a property for construction, landscaping, or other development projects. This process typically includes the removal of unwanted vegetation, debris, and sometimes small structures, creating a clear and level space. Property owners often request ground clearing for new construction, driveway installation, yard renovations, or to improve safety and accessibility on their land. Before requesting this service, it’s helpful to understand the size of the area to be cleared, the types of vegetation or obstacles involved, and any local regulations or permits that may be required.
Property owners should also consider the potential impact on existing landscaping or natural features and communicate any specific preferences or restrictions. Clarifying the scope of work, including whether stump grinding or debris removal is needed, can help ensure the project meets expectations. Understanding the condition of the land, access points, and the presence of underground utilities can facilitate a smoother clearing process. Proper planning and clear communication can help achieve a safe, efficient, and effective ground clearing outcome.

Common Ground Clearing Jobs
Land Clearing - prepares property for construction or development by removing trees, brush, and debris.
Stump Removal - eliminates tree stumps to improve landscape safety and aesthetics.
Overgrown Lot Clearing - restores neglected or overgrown areas for easier maintenance and use.
Fence Line Clearing - clears vegetation along property boundaries to ensure proper fencing installation.
Construction Site Clearing - provides a clean, level surface for building projects and infrastructure.
Brush and Debris Removal - clears unwanted vegetation and debris to enhance property appearance and safety.
Ground Clearing Questions
What is ground clearing? Ground clearing involves removing trees, shrubs, and debris to prepare land for construction, landscaping, or other projects.
What types of properties benefit from ground clearing? Residential yards, commercial sites, and vacant land can all require ground clearing for development or maintenance purposes.
What equipment is used in ground clearing? Heavy machinery like bulldozers, excavators, and stump grinders are typically used to efficiently clear land.
Is ground clearing suitable for small or large projects? Ground clearing services can accommodate both small residential lots and large commercial or industrial sites.
